Waldo Home Sales Stats – Aug 2017

Waldo home prices continue to climb this year…and houses are selling very fast!  Usually the market slows down after the July 4 holiday–not in Waldo!  Here are the Aug 2017 stats and comparisons to 2016.  The boundaries I’m using are State Line to Holmes; Gregory to 85th St.

August 2017

Median list price:     $175,000

Median sales price:  $178,000

No. of homes sold:       33

Days on market:           8

The highest sale was $326,000 and the lowest closed price was $115,000.  Notice the sales price was higher than the listed price!

August 2016

Median list price:      $150,000

Median sales price:   $146,000

No. of homes sold:       46

Days on market:          34

Comparing Aug 2017 to Aug 2016–a 21% increase in prices!  Here are year to date stats:

Jan-Aug 2017

Median list price:        $175,000

Median sales price:    $176,500

No. of homes sold:       270

Days on market:           15

Jan-Aug 2016

Median list price:       $164,975

Median sales price:    $163,975

No. of homes sold:        268

Days on market:            21

This year, homes are selling faster and for higher prices in Waldo.  Year to date, median sales price is up 7.6%.  Currently there are 23 single family homes for sale in Waldo, with a median list price of $163,900.

(All stats taken from Heartland MLS; deemed reliable but not guaranteed.)

Design in the City Opens 2cd Location in Brookside

You may have noticed a new shop along 63rd St in Brookside:  Design in the City has moved into the former Reading Reptile location.  This is the second location for Design in the City; the first one is in Briarcliff.

IMG_3590

Design in the City opens in Brookside

IMG_3606Proprietor Mindy Diaz told me there were two reasons she chose this spot:  many of her customers wanted a ‘south’ location, and her best friend is Pam DiCappo, who owns Lauren Alexander next door.  She felt her lines of clothing and accessories would complement the other shops in the area.  This is a store you will love browsing in–everything is so  beautifully displayed! Jackets, pants, tops, purses, boots, hats and jewelry catch your eye at every turn.  Her most popular lines include Tart Collections, Sanctuary and Chaser Brand for clothing; she also has jewelry from Simon Sebbag, Kendra Scott and Tat2.  You’ll also find some fun gift and decor items here: pillows, party accessories, greeting cards, wall hangings, etc.  And of course, personal, friendly service is always present.

IMG_3591Mindy’s background is in interior design. She worked for her Dad in a building supplies business for many years; then took some time off to raise her son.  She got the itch to go back to work and opened a home furnishings store in Parkville.  Then she switched to selling clothes when opening the Briarcliff store.  She loves having a store in Brookside because of the “amazing neighbors who support locally owned businesses”.

Armour Hills Home Sales Report-Aug 2017

The Armour Hills subdivision in Brookside continues to be a desireable location for homebuyers this year–prices are up compared to 2016.  Here are the stats for August 2017, with a year to date comparison as well.

Aug 2017

Median list price:     $285,000

Median sales price:  $285,000

No. of houses sold:     11

Days on market:          19

Aug 2016

Median list price:     $254,500

Median sales price:   $254,000

No. of houses sold:       8

Days on market:          13

The highest closed price was $421,750 and the lowest was $235,000.  There is very little, if any, negotiation on list price.  

Here are the year to date stats:

Jan-Aug 2017

Median list price:     $315,000

Median sales price:  $312,500

No. of houses sold:       71

Days on market:           7

Jan-Aug 2106

Median list price:     $269,950

Median sales price:  $272,250

No. of houses sold:      56

Days on market:           13

Prices are up about 14% year to date–wow, that is quite a jump!  However, I don’t think final 2017 stats will show that much of an increase. Still, higher prices mean more equity for sellers and buyers are comfortable paying more to live in our neighborhood.  Currently there are five homes for sale in Armour Hills, with a median list price of $335,000 and 7 days on market.

(Stats taken from Heartland MLS; deemed reliable but not guaranteed.)

Brookside Home Sales Report-Aug 2016

As we get into the second half of the year…the home buying market starts slowing down.  Sales have been  strong this year in Brookside (list price under $450K); there is still demand, but most of the inventory is priced well over $500K.  Here is the August  2017 Brookside single family home sales report, using stats from zip code 64113:
Aug 2017
Median list price:        $376,500

Median sales price:    $358,000

Number of homes sold:    24

Days on market:               37
The lowest closed price was $235,000 and the highest was $770,000.
Aug 2016
Median list price:        $328,900

Median sales price:    $322,000

Number of homes sold:   30

Days on market:              13
Sales prices are up 11% compared to last August.  Checking year-to-date figures:
Jan-Aug 2017
Median list price:        $379,995

Median sales price:    $365,000

Number of homes sold:  209

Days on market:              19
Jan-Aug  2016
Median list price:         $357,250

Median sales price:     $351,500

Number of homes sold:   223

Days on market:               34
Year to date, home prices are up 3.8% and going under contract faster than 2016.  Currently, there are 47 homes for sale in Brookside, with a median list price of $589,000.  Over half of the homes on the market are listed over $500,000, pushing that median price way up.
(All stats taken from Heartland MLS; deemed reliable but not guaranteed.)

Waldo Home Sales Report – July 2017

Home prices are up again in Waldo–a trend that has been consistent this year.  There is a lot of demand and not enough inventory in the $150-$200K price range.  I’ve said that just about every month this year!

These figures are for Waldo single family home sales, using the boundaries of State Line to Holmes and Gregory to 85th:

July 2017

Number of homes sold:    34

Median list price:              $149,000

Median sales price:          $162,000

Average days on market:    11

July 2016

Number of homes sold:      43

Median list price:              $165,000

Median sales price:          $166,000

Average days on market:    9

The highest price sale in Waldo last month was $320,400 and the lowest was $64,250. Note the sales price was higher than list price–because many of the homes that closed were at or over the asking price.

Here are year-to-date comparisons:

Jan-July  2017

Number of homes sold:   165

Median list price:            $175,000

Median sales price:        $177,500

Average days on market:  26

Jan-July 2016

Number of homes sold:    152

Median list price:             $165,500

Median sales price           $164,475

Average days on market:   25

Waldo home prices are up 5.3% year to date–and so many homes are selling over the list price!  Waldo is a hot spot for home buyers.  Currently there are 17 homes for sale, with a median list price of $179,997 and 31 days on market.

(All figures taken from Heartland MLS; deemed reliable but not guaranteed.)

 

Armour Hills July 2017 Home Sales Report

Armour Hills in Brookside — a hot location for homebuyers this year!  Prices have really jumped up from one year ago.  Here are the July 2017 home sales for Armour Hills, and a comparison to last year.

July 2017                                              

Median list price:      $335,000                          

Median sales price:  $335,000                          

Number of homes sold:  6  

Days on market:               5                   

July 2016        

Median list price:       $254,500

Median sales price:   $256,000     

Number of homes sold:   8  

Days on market:                5

The lowest sales price in July  2017 was $249,900 and the highest was $397,500.      

Now let’s look at year to date:

Jan- July 2017                                

Median list price:      $320,000

Median sales price:  $322,500

Number of homes sold:  59

Days on market:              7                           

Jan- July 2016

Median list price:        $275,000

Median sales price:     $274,500

Number of homes sold:  47

Days on market:               11

Home prices are up 17% YTD!  It will be interesting to see what the numbers are for 2017 as a whole. I don’t think year end stats will be quite that high.  However, note that most homes are selling at list price or over.   Currently in Armour Hills there are five active listings with a median price of $385,000 and 41 days on market.       

(All stats taken from Heartland MLS; deemed reliable but not guaranteed.)
